What “quality” looks like in a custom build

The right motherboard, reliable power supply, and properly matched RAM can prevent instability and unwanted bottlenecks. Storage choices matter too: a fast SSD improves load times and custom pc singapore responsiveness, while sufficient capacity helps you keep more titles installed without constant deletions. When parts are chosen with real-world gaming workloads in mind, the system feels smoother and more predictable during long play sessions.

Cooling is another major sign of quality, particularly for high-performance builds that may run for hours. Effective airflow design, capable CPU cooling, and thermal management help sustain boost clocks and reduce thermal throttling. Cable management also plays a practical role by improving airflow and making future upgrades easier. Finally, a quality build includes thoughtful settings and validation so the desktop starts cleanly and performs as expected from the first session.

Choosing the right specs for your games and workload

Your gaming needs determine the best balance of CPU, GPU, RAM, and storage. Competitive players often value high frame rates and low latency, which makes GPU and memory configuration critical. Story-driven games with higher visual complexity may benefit from stronger graphics performance and faster storage to reduce streaming delays. For creators or multitaskers, additional cores, adequate RAM, and storage capacity help maintain smooth performance when using editing tools alongside games.

A quality-minded builder can map your priorities to a practical parts list without overspending on unused features. It’s also smart to consider upgrade paths, since a well-designed platform makes future GPU or storage upgrades straightforward. This approach protects your investment and supports ongoing performance as your library and software demands grow.
